WebJan 15, 2024 · That represents a 50% increase from the 96 women who were serving in the 112th Congress a decade ago, though it remains far below the female share of the overall U.S. population. A record 120 women are serving in the newly elected House, accounting for 27% of the total. In the Senate, women hold 24 of 100 seats, one fewer than the record …

WebFeb 7, 2024 · With Balint’s election, all 50 states have now had female representation in U.S. Congress at some point. U.S. population has tripled since 1910, and the fixed number of seats creates serious disparities among the states in the number of people per representative.
